Understanding the Basics of Pudding

Pudding, at its core, is a dessert characterized by its creamy texture and often sweet flavor. It can be made with various ingredients, including milk, eggs, sugar, cornstarch, and flavorings. The key to successful pudding lies in understanding the role of each ingredient and mastering the cooking process.

Essential Ingredients for Baking Pudding

1. Milk: The foundation of most puddings, milk provides moisture and richness. You can use whole milk, low-fat milk, or even plant-based milk alternatives like almond milk or soy milk.

2. Eggs: Eggs add structure, richness, and a velvety texture to pudding. They also help thicken the mixture.

3. Sugar: Sugar provides sweetness and balances the flavors of other ingredients. You can adjust the amount of sugar to your preference.

4. Cornstarch: Cornstarch is a thickening agent that creates the smooth and creamy texture of pudding. It’s important to use the right amount of cornstarch to ensure your pudding sets properly.

5. Flavorings: The possibilities for flavorings are endless! You can use vanilla extract, chocolate, fruit purees, spices, or even alcohol to add depth and complexity to your pudding.

Mastering the Cooking Process

1. Preparing the Ingredients: Gather all your ingredients and measure them carefully. Make sure the milk is warmed slightly before adding it to the saucepan.

2. Combining the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the cornstarch and sugar. This helps prevent lumps from forming.

3. Gradually Adding the Milk: Slowly whisk the warm milk into the dry ingredients, ensuring a smooth and lump-free mixture.

4. Cooking the Pudding: Pour the mixture into a saucepan and cook over medium heat, stirring constantly. As the mixture heats up, it will thicken. Continue cooking until the pudding reaches the desired consistency.

5. Cooling and Serving: Once the pudding is cooked, remove it from the heat and stir in your chosen flavorings. Allow the pudding to cool slightly before serving.

Tips for Baking Perfect Pudding

1. Don’t Overcook: Overcooked pudding can become thick and rubbery. Watch it closely and stir continuously to prevent scorching.

2. Use a Thermometer: A thermometer is helpful for ensuring the pudding reaches the correct temperature. Most pudding recipes require a temperature of 170°F (77°C).

3. Chill Before Serving: Chilling the pudding in the refrigerator for a few hours will allow it to set properly and enhance its flavor.

FAQs

1. Can I substitute cornstarch for another thickening agent?

Yes, you can use arrowroot powder or tapioca starch as substitutes for cornstarch. However, the amount needed may vary.

2. How long can I store pudding in the refrigerator?

Homemade pudding can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.

3. Can I freeze pudding?

While it’s not recommended to freeze pudding, you can freeze it for a short period of time. However, the texture may change slightly after thawing.
